My name is Liu Yiwan... no, it's Liu Yiwan.

I asked the old man why other people's parents were with them, but where were my parents? The old man smiled and didn't say anything.

It was a rather cold season, and I had just woken up wearing only a coarse cloth. I vaguely remembered carving something on a wooden board before falling asleep, and I don't know why, but when I woke up I was in this place. There was a piece of cloth tucked beside me, with crooked writing on it. I saw a sedan chair approaching in the distance. I sat by the roadside watching it grow closer. The person in front of the sedan chair glanced at me and told me to stay away. The person inside said, "He's just a child. The servants always leave him a bowl of food at mealtimes." That's why the young master later named me Liu Yiwan.

Young Master Tang is a rather unreliable person; he's been a crybaby since he was little. Even though he's a boy, he often cries his eyes out in front of me, leaving me completely helpless. It's all thanks to him that I was allowed to stay in the manor. If he hadn't kept me, I probably would have been sent somewhere else.

A few days ago, the young master seemed to be possessed by something and went horseback riding with Young Master Zhang. Not long after, someone reported that he had disappeared on horseback, but was later found in the south of the city, far from the horse farm. There used to be a famous tofu shop in the south of the city, and when they found the young master, he was as limp as tofu. He had gone out upright in the morning, but I had to carry him back. I was terrified and rushed to find a doctor to examine him. The doctor took his pulse and said there was nothing seriously wrong. But after the young master woke up, he seemed not to recognize me, even praising my name, and complaining about his beloved purse. He then climbed over the wall to visit a brothel, after which he was punished by the master with family discipline…

Young Master Zhang went out again with the neighbor's son, Zhang Gongzi. When I saw him, he was standing in a haystack with a baby in his arms, and an old woman with an arrow piercing her abdomen was lying in front of him. I quickly threw two darts to repel the black-clad man with the arrow, and Young Master told me to take the baby back to the manor. The next day, Young Master gave me a jade pendant and asked me to go to Yunhai Pavilion to redeem a girl named Qin Jiujiu. Young Master, having just escaped death, is already thinking of a girl; he's in such good health!

"This humble servant greets you, young master," were Qin Jiujiu's first words to me. This woman was truly beautiful; her skin was as white as snow, and her features were exquisite. I was momentarily captivated by her beauty. She softly asked what business she had with me. After I showed her the jade pendant engraved with her name and told her I had come to redeem her from her servitude, her sudden tears sent a shiver down my spine. For a while afterward, I pondered why this was, as I had never felt this way before.

And so, I brought Miss Qin back to the manor, suppressing my doubts, and prepared to go back to my room to change into clean clothes. I overheard the maids coming from the direction of the main hall talking about the woodshed; it seemed the young master intended to give my room to the young lady. I hurried to the main hall, and when Miss Qin said she and her brother would be fine together, I felt completely relieved. It wasn't that I didn't want to give the room to the young lady, but the woodshed was dry, and I'm prone to getting a sore throat. Dry firewood meeting my sore throat… well… it was for the safety of the manor, not that I didn't want to sleep in the woodshed, no, that's not it!
